coverage
Data breach response
Forensic investigation to find what happened, legal counsel, notification to affected individuals, credit monitoring, call center support, and PR assistance. The full response package that activates the moment you discover a breach.
Ransomware and cyber extortion
Ransom payment (where legally permitted), negotiation services, system restoration, and data recovery. Ransomware is the most common cyber claim for small and mid-sized businesses. Your policy covers the full event
Business interruption
Lost income and extra expenses when a cyber event takes your systems offline. Your revenue stops when your network goes down. This coverage replaces it while you recover.
Social engineering and wire fraud
Losses from fraudulent wire transfers, invoice manipulation, and business email compromise. Someone impersonates your CEO and tricks accounting into sending $50K. This coverage responds to that.
Regulatory defense and fines
Legal defense and regulatory penalties from data privacy violations. As privacy regulations expand, the cost of non-compliance is rising. This covers the defense and the fines.
Third-party liability
Lawsuits from customers, clients, or partners alleging your security failure caused them harm. When their data is compromised because of your breach, they sue you. This responds to that.
